During the recent Board of Education meeting on September 28, 2021, the Montgomery Township School District discussed significant changes to the school lunch program aimed at enhancing student meal options. The board highlighted the introduction of a more diverse menu, which includes five to six hot items available daily, alongside cold selections.

This shift comes in response to feedback regarding the current offerings, which have been perceived as limited compared to neighboring districts. A board member noted their experience in South Brunswick, where a wider variety of hot food options was successfully implemented. The goal is to improve student satisfaction and encourage healthier eating habits among students.

In addition to the menu changes, the board acknowledged the importance of adhering to safety protocols during meal service, particularly in light of ongoing health concerns. The discussions reflect a commitment to providing nutritious meals while ensuring the safety and well-being of students.

As the district moves forward with these enhancements, the board is optimistic that the improved lunch offerings will positively impact student engagement and overall school experience. The next steps will involve monitoring the implementation of the new menu and gathering feedback from students and parents to ensure the changes meet community needs.
